Jamón Jamón
Dir: Bigas Luna
1992
****
I think I probibly prefer Jamon Jamon to most of Lunas's films because it is erotic and sexy without the tastelessness he is often guilty of (see Ages of Lulu). First off, this film made me want to go to Spain, it really is quite seductive. It's also quite funny (nude bullfighting anyone?) That said, it's not an Almodovar film. I know that may seem like an obvious and somewhat lazy comparison but it is hard not to compare the two directors. The acting is spot on, Penelope Cruz and Javier Bardem are both brilliant and it is easy to see why the world suddenly took notice of them both. I didn't care for the story at times however, and I have to say I did have issues with the possible animal cruelty here (I hope I'm wrong). It was funny but not laugh out loud funny. The conclusion was a little too predictable and a little farcical for my liking but still, I liked it. It is more than just Penelope Cruz and Javier Bardem having sex with each other anyway.
